Где бэкенд код отвечающий за поиск в блогах?
Вебаситс 6 версия. Создано несколько блогов. Проблема в том, что поиск работает в каждом блоге по отдельности, а не суммарно ищет во всех блогах с формы запроса.
Не понимаю зачем было делать такую неправильную и неудобную логику, ведь для посетителю сайта 100% даже не придет в голову, что он работает таким вот образом!!! Поиск - должен работать по всему сайту(блогу или каталогу), а не по каким-то подразделам. Простого решения данной проблемы не нашел.
Может кто-то подскажет, какой фрагмент кода или хотя бы в каком файле он, который отвечает за поиск в блоге. (я не имею ввиду код, который в теме средствами smarty, a php на бэкенде)?
Нужно для поиска объединить все подблоги в один сайт - в понятную логику для посетителя.
Всем заранее огромное спасибо, кто уделил время на прочтение поста и за участие в нем!
2 ответа
wa-apps/blog/lib/actions/frontend/blogFrontend.action.php
метод execute начиная с
$query = $this->getRequest()->get('query', '', waRequest::TYPE_STRING_TRIM);
Николай, спасибо Вам огромное!
Хорошего дня.